Pair of early U.S. military-related documents spanning from the post-War of 1812 to pre-Civil War era. 1828 Pennsylvania Militia Commission issued to Anthony Lanser of the 10th Company, 97th Regiment, 1st Brigade, 7th Division of Militia. Issued by the Governor’s Office and signed by Calvin Blythe, Secretary of State. Measures approximately 13 x 11 inches overall. Document has folds and left side has been trimmed. Fragile condition with separation and repairs on verso using aged tape. Lanser’s signature appears on the reverse. 1854 Presidential Land Grant issued to Harvey Dean, referencing War of 1812 service by Elisha Barber, Private in Capt. Webster’s Company, Connecticut Militia. The grant was for 40 acres located in Columbus County, Wisconsin. Folded, measures approximately 15.5 x 9.5 inches. Includes official blind seal.
